The fan is the only moving part on the graphics card, running it at full blast all the time might lengthen the … boxing flicker stanceWitryna17 sie 2011 · The heat generated by the GPU has to go somewhere. Setting your fan @ 100% will help to remove the heat faster from your GPU, making the temperature of your GPU to lower down, but heat will leave your case and enter your room even faster. So room temps will not decrease at all! . Save. gurukul foundation school kashipur logoWitryna5 wrz 2024 · Ok, so here's the thing.
